No Abstract Molecular Spintronics In their Focus review on page 1154 ff., Masahiro Yamashita et al. summarize the results of studies on the switching of the Kondo signal for double-decker bis(phthalocyaninato)terbium(III) lanthanoid single-molecule magnets, [TbPc2], on Au(111), which is a spin one-half (S=1/2) Kondo system because of the ligand spin, not the Tb3+ spin. In these sandwich complexes, the upper ligand can be rotated in a controlled manner, thereby switching the ligand spin on and off. Thus, information can be encoded at the single-molecule level by controlling the molecular spin through an electric current. Metal Hydrides An experimental/computational study on the thermal activation of ammonia by cationic transition-metal hydrides MH+ is presented by Robert Kretschmer, Maria Schlangen, and Helmut Schwarz in their Full paper on page 1214 ff. Amide formation accompanied by loss of H2 is observed for all ions except ZnH+. Further, proton transfer takes place for the middle and late transition metals from MnH+ to ZnH+. Finally, ligand exchange under the formation of M(NH3)+ proceeds only when using CrH+, CoH+, and NiH+. The underlying mechanisms have been uncovered by labeling experiments and quantum chemical calculations, respectively." @default.
